1. A semiconductor power converter apparatus comprising:

  • a semiconductor power conversion circuit in which a first semiconductor element having a temperature sensing unit and a second semiconductor element having a current sensing unit are connected in parallel, for causing the first and second semiconductor elements to perform switching operations;

    an overheat protection circuit for performing overheating protection for the first and second semiconductor elements based on temperature information obtained from the temperature sensing unit of the first semiconductor element;

    an overcurrent protection circuit for performing overcurrent protection for the first and second semiconductor elements based on current information obtained from the current sensing unit of the second semiconductor element;

    a current sensor for sensing an output current of the semiconductor power conversion circuit, andmeans for determining that one of the first and second semiconductor elements fails to limit the output current of the semiconductor power conversion circuit if a detected value of the current sensor is equal to or lower than a predetermined set value, during operation of the overcurrent protection circuit or the overheat protection circuit.
